Hi, I am Michele, nature guide, and I will guide you on a journey through history, nature and tradition to discover the ancient stavoli of Hinterseike. Starting from Sauris di Sotto, we will walk along the path that crosses woods and meadows until we reach some fascinating stone and wood constructions that tell of the balance between man and nature. Hinterseike, which in the Sauris language means behind the headland, is a place where every corner seems to whisper stories from the past.
On the way, I will tell you about Vaja, the 2018 storm that left its mark on these mountains, which are now shrouded in snow. We will also pass the church of San Lorenzo and arrive in Hozach, from where we will leave Sauris di Sopra, enjoying a spectacular view of Mount Bivera at sunset, a panorama that looks like a postcard.
